Transaction fed2434946a2b38a1302c8592ca52f9b8ab51275ab7c441487e2c0a8ef26e2f6
1 Input
1 Output
-
fed2434946a2b38a1302c8592ca52f9b8ab51275ab7c441487e2c0a8ef26e2f6:0
- value
- 23466000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a4efce0c2b485f8950fe2cd205a066676a052bf OP_EQUAL
- address
- 3HDXRKjX82ANRAeX176qWuPmF5vDKHsc6v